WebJul 7, 2024 · Execute the following command to delete the tag " ongoing ". git tag -d ongoing. Note: The "d" flag used with git tag denotes that we are requesting a delete operation. Git responds with a success message of the deletion of the tag. In addition to this, the hash code of the operation ( d3d18bd) is also a part of the Git response. If desired, review the staged changes: git status # display a list of changed files git diff --cached # shows staged changes inside staged files. Finally, commit the changes: git commit -m "Commit message here". Alternately, if you have only modified existing files or deleted files, and have not created any new ones, you can combine ...
